Program Development Manager Visa Sponsorship Jobs in New Hampshire

Program development manager roles in New Hampshire are concentrated around Manchester, Concord, and the Nashua corridor, where employers in healthcare, defense contracting, and higher education regularly hire for this function. Organizations like Dartmouth Health, BAE Systems, and the University of New Hampshire have sponsored international workers in program and project management roles.

Program Development Manager Jobs in New Hampshire: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for program development managers in New Hampshire?

Employers with documented sponsorship activity in New Hampshire's program management space include BAE Systems in Nashua, Dartmouth Health in Lebanon, and technology firms in the Manchester-Nashua corridor. Higher education institutions such as the University of New Hampshire and Dartmouth College also sponsor international professionals in program development and administrative management roles. Defense contractors operating in southern New Hampshire tend to file the highest volume of sponsorship petitions.

Which visa types are most common for program development manager roles in New Hampshire?

The H-1B is the most common visa category for program development managers in New Hampshire, as the role typically requires a bachelor's degree in business, public administration, education, or a related field, meeting the specialty occupation standard. Candidates already in the U.S. on F-1 OPT or STEM OPT may work in this role while a sponsor files an H-1B petition. L-1B transfers are also used when a multinational employer moves an internal candidate to a New Hampshire office.

Which cities in New Hampshire have the most program development manager sponsorship jobs?

Manchester and Nashua account for the largest share of program development manager opportunities in New Hampshire, driven by the concentration of healthcare systems, defense contractors, and technology employers. Concord, as the state capital, adds public-sector and nonprofit program management roles. Lebanon and Hanover in the Upper Valley are worth monitoring given Dartmouth Health and Dartmouth College, both of which have sponsored international staff in comparable positions.

Are there state-specific or role-specific considerations for program development managers pursuing sponsorship in New Hampshire?

New Hampshire has no state income tax, which affects how employers structure total compensation packages but does not directly change sponsorship eligibility. For H-1B petitions, the sponsoring employer must certify a prevailing wage through a Labor Condition Application filed with the Department of Labor. Program development manager roles in New Hampshire's defense sector may also require security clearance eligibility, which some employers factor into hiring decisions for sponsored candidates. Public university positions sometimes follow different sponsorship timelines tied to academic hiring cycles.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ored program development manager jobs in New Hampshire?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
